Every Lucky Tradition, Perfectly Executed
Brazilians take Réveillon food traditions seriously: lentils for prosperity, pomegranate seeds scattered for luck, seven white foods on the table. A myChef personal chef knows these customs and builds them into your menu authentically, not as an afterthought.

View all→Réveillon in Brasília: A City Built for Private Celebrations
Brasília was designed as no other city in Brazil — superquadras with shared green spaces, lake-facing mansions in Lago Sul and Lago Norte, rooftop terraces in Noroeste and Sudoeste. When December 31st arrives, the capital's residents don't head to a beach. They dress in white, gather at home, and create the most elaborate dinner of the year. The city's culture of diplomatic entertaining makes Réveillon meals here especially refined.
The Federal District draws people from every Brazilian state, and Réveillon tables in Brasília reflect that: a family from Bahia brings dendê traditions, a gaúcho expat expects a churrasco station, a diplomat's family wants a French-influenced champagne dinner. Your personal chef navigates all of it — building a menu that honors the lucky food traditions of the new year while reflecting exactly who is sitting at your table.
From the Cerrado's unique pantry — baru nuts from Brazlândia, pequi from the Chapada, honey from cerrado bees — to premium imports available at Brasília's high-end supermarkets, your chef sources ingredients that make your Réveillon feel genuinely Brasiliense, not a copy of a coastal party.
